Title:
READING MODULE, IMAGE READING DEVICE COMPRISING SAME, AND IMAGE FORMING DEVICE

Abstract:
A reading module (50) comprising: a light source (31) that irradiates a document (60); an optical system (40) that comprises a mirror array (35) and a diaphragm (37) and forms an image using, as image light, reflected light from the light irradiated on to the document (60) from the light source (31); a sensor (41) having arranged therein a plurality of image-forming areas (41a, 41b) that convert the image light formed into an image by the optical system (40), into electric signals; a case (30); and a light-shielding wall (43) that blocks stray light incident to each image-forming area (41a, 41b). The mirror array (35) has a plurality of reflective mirrors (35a–35c) that have aspherical recessed reflective surfaces and are coupled in an array shape in a main scanning direction. The optical system (40) is fixed to the case (30) at one point in the main scanning direction and each light-shielding wall (34) is arranged at a position displaced by a prescribed amount from the boundary of each image-forming area (41a, 41b) in the opposite direction to the side on which the optical system (40) is fixed.
